#acf0df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#acf0df is composed of 67.5% red, 94.1% green and 87.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 28.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 7.1%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 165 degrees, a saturation of 69.4% and a lightness of 80.8%. #acf0df color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#59e1bf. Closest websafe color is: #99ffcc.

#acf0df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#acf0df has RGB values of R:172, G:240, B:223 and CMYK values of C:0.28, M:0, Y:0.07,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 11333855.
